Resolving dependencies... Downloading hpuz-1.1.2... Configuring hpuz-1.1.2... Building hpuz-1.1.2... Preprocessing library hpuz-1.1.2... [1 of 2] Compiling Codec.Game.Puz.Internal ( dist/build/Codec/Game/Puz/Internal.hs, dist/build/Codec/Game/Puz/Internal.o ) Codec/Game/Puz/Internal.chs:16:1: Warning: Top-level binding with no type signature: withPuzHead :: forall b. PuzHead -> (Ptr PuzHead -> IO b) -> IO b Codec/Game/Puz/Internal.chs:18:1: Warning: Top-level binding with no type signature: withPuz :: forall b. Puz -> (Ptr Puz -> IO b) -> IO b Codec/Game/Puz/Internal.chs:160:28: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:168: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:180: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:192: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:204:33: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:216: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:228: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:240: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:252: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:264: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:280:33: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:292: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:308: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:319:35: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:331: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:353: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:369: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:385: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:401:29: Warning: Defined but not used: `res' [2 of 2] Compiling Codec.Game.Puz ( Codec/Game/Puz.hs, dist/build/Codec/Game/Puz.o ) contrib/libpuz/src/load.c: In function ‘load_ltim_bin’: contrib/libpuz/src/load.c:224: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/load.c: In function ‘puz_load_bin’: contrib/libpuz/src/load.c:366: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/load.c:372: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/load.c: In function ‘puz_load_text’: contrib/libpuz/src/load.c:887:32: warning: pointer targets in initialization differ in signedness [-Wpointer-sign] contrib/libpuz/src/save.c: In function ‘puz_save_bin’: contrib/libpuz/src/save.c:177:5: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c: In function ‘puz_rtblstr_set’: contrib/libpuz/src/puzzle.c:765:5: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c: In function ‘puz_rusrstr_get’: contrib/libpuz/src/puzzle.c:1043:7: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c: In function ‘unshift_string’: contrib/libpuz/src/puzzle.c:1214: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c:1215: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c: In function ‘puz_unlock_solution’: contrib/libpuz/src/puzzle.c:1329:3: warning: value computed is not used [-Wunused-value] contrib/libpuz/src/puzzle.c: In function ‘puz_brute_force_unlock’: contrib/libpuz/src/puzzle.c:1394:3: warning: statement with no effect [-Wunused-value] In-place registering hpuz-1.1.2... Running Haddock for hpuz-1.1.2... Running hscolour for hpuz-1.1.2... Preprocessing library hpuz-1.1.2... Preprocessing library hpuz-1.1.2... Codec/Game/Puz/Internal.chs:16:1: Warning: Top-level binding with no type signature: withPuzHead :: forall b. PuzHead -> (Ptr PuzHead -> IO b) -> IO b Codec/Game/Puz/Internal.chs:18:1: Warning: Top-level binding with no type signature: withPuz :: forall b. Puz -> (Ptr Puz -> IO b) -> IO b Codec/Game/Puz/Internal.chs:160:28: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:168: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:180: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:192: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:204:33: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:216: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:228: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:240: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:252: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:264: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:280:33: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:292: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:308:30: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:319:35: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:331: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:353:34: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:369:31: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:385:29: Warning: Defined but not used: `res' Codec/Game/Puz/Internal.chs:401:29: Warning: Defined but not used: `res' Haddock coverage: 0% ( 0 /128) in 'Codec.Game.Puz.Internal' Warning: Codec.Game.Puz: width is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: height is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: grid is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: solution is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: title is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: author is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: notes is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: copyright is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: timer is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: clues is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. Warning: Codec.Game.Puz: locked is exported separately but will be documented under Puzzle. Consider exporting it together with its parent(s) for code clarity. 25% ( 3 / 12) in 'Codec.Game.Puz' Warning: Codec.Game.Puz: could not find link destinations for: Codec.Game.Puz.ErrMsg Documentation created: dist/doc/html/hpuz/index.html, dist/doc/html/hpuz/hpuz.txt Installing library in /srv/hackage/var/build/tmp-install/lib/x86_64-linux-ghc-7.6.3/hpuz-1.1.2 Registering hpuz-1.1.2... Installed hpuz-1.1.2